SEOUL South Korea and the United States agreed to explore all possible options to rein in North Korean provocations during a phone call between U.S. National Security Advisor Michael Flynn and his South Korean counterpart Kim Kwan-jin, South Korea’s presidential Blue House said.

Flynn had requested the call with Kim after North Korea test-fired a ballistic missile early on Sunday, the Blue House said in a statement.
